Cessna Assumes Full Ownership of CitationAir

CitationAir (nee CitationShares) is now a wholly owned entity of Cessna Aircraft. The manufacturer recently acquired the final 8 percent of the financial interest. The program began in 2000 as a fractional share company, half owned by Cessna and half by TAG Aviation. In the years since, the program has grown and evolved to include […]

Santulli Steps Down as Head of NetJets

Richard Santulli, the Wall Street mathematician who left Goldman Sachs to form NetJets in 1986, stepped down Tuesday as Chairman and CEO. Santulli is credited with inventing the fractional aircraft ownership business model.
